
Cynthia Paris (she/her)
Cynthia Paris is dedicated to helping individuals and groups rediscover joy, connection, and meaningful stress relief. With over 30 years of experience in the helping professions, she blends her background in Experiential Therapy, Emotional Intelligence and Mindfulness to create uplifting experiences that are both playful and deeply restorative.
As the Director of Team COA, formerly a division of Rogers Behavioral Health and now an independent organization, Cynthia specializes in leading programs that bring connection, creativity and well being to workplaces, conferences, senior communities. Cynthia and her team are known for work with adult and youth groups of all kinds in the teamwork, emotional intelligence and mental health industry.
Trained by Dr. Madan Kataria, Cynthia is also the Founder of Laughter Yoga USA,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it. This organization is the first of its kind worldwide.
Run entirely by volunteers, goals include supporting Laughter Yoga professionals with tools needed to increase their skills and presence in their own communities. Providing conferences, gatherings and online events to connect with other professionals too. Spreading the concept of LY to potential participants and underserved communities is another area of focus as well.
